In the realm of municipal and industrial water infrastructure, the "Total Cost of Ownership" (TCO) is a more critical metric than initial construction cost. Engineers and facility managers are increasingly moving away from traditional, high-maintenance materials like poured concrete and welded carbon steel, favoring a technology that offers a proven 30-year service life: Glass-Fused-to-Steel (GFS).
As water scarcity and infrastructure resilience become top-of-mind priorities for 2026, investing in a storage solution that withstands the test of time is no longer a luxury—it is an operational necessity.
The longevity of a GFS tank is not accidental; it is the result of advanced materials science. During the manufacturing process, silicate glass frit is fused to high-strength steel plates at temperatures ranging from 820°C to 930°C.
This fusion creates a molecular, inorganic bond that is harder than steel and more inert than plastic. Unlike paint or epoxy, which sits on top of the metal and eventually degrades, the glass-enamel coating becomes an integrated part of the panel surface.
Immunity to Corrosion: Water—especially treated, chlorinated, or mineral-rich water—can aggressively attack steel. The inert glass barrier is impervious to rust and oxidation, eliminating the root cause of tank failure.
Non-Porous, Hygienic Surface: The glass surface is exceptionally smooth (microscopically pore-free). This prevents the accumulation of biofilms, algae, and mineral deposits, ensuring that your water quality remains compliant with health standards without requiring frequent, intensive cleaning.
Mechanical Resilience: The fusion process creates a composite material that resists scratches, impacts, and the abrasive wear often found in high-flow water applications.
When selecting infrastructure that must serve for decades, the trade-offs between materials become clear.
| Feature | Glass-Fused-to-Steel | Poured Concrete | Welded Carbon Steel |
| Service Life | 30+ Years | 20–30 Years | 15–25 Years |
| Maintenance | Minimal | High (Crack Repair) | High (Periodic Recoating) |
| Construction Speed | Fast (Modular) | Slow (Curing Time) | Moderate |
| Hygienic Profile | High (Non-Porous) | Low (Porous) | Moderate |
| Lifecycle Cost | Lowest | Moderate | High |
Reduced Operational Expenditure (OpEx): Because the glass-fused surface does not require periodic sandblasting or repainting, your facility avoids the major maintenance shutdowns that plague welded steel or concrete tanks.
Modular Scalability: Water demand often grows with population or industrial activity. GFS tanks are bolted structures; if your storage needs increase, you can often add additional rings or panels to your existing tank, protecting your initial capital investment.
Site Efficiency: These tanks are "flat-packed" and shipped to the site. Construction involves assembly using precision bolting, which requires significantly less space and specialized equipment than casting a concrete reservoir. This makes GFS the preferred choice for remote or constrained urban sites.
